‘Quarantine,’ ‘Devil’ Directors Overthrow ‘The Coup’

Published

on

We got exclusive word that John Erick Dowdle and Drew Dowdle – the duo behind The Poughkeepsie Tapes, the REC redo, Quarantine, and M. Night Shyamalan’s Devil – are finally getting their overseas thriller The Coup off the ground (first mentioned back in July 2008). Bloody Disgusting learned that Lionsgate is producing the pic that will center on an American family that moves to Cambodia for work just as a rebel mob takes over and starts killing all Americans. The Dowdle brothers will both be directing the thriller from a screenplay penned by John. No word on when shooting gets underway, but word has it Lionsgate is working quickly.

Memory Loss Leads to a Hospital Freakout in ‘This Tempting Madness’ Exclusive Clip

Published

on

This Tempting Madness clip

A hospital stay grows more nerve-frazzling when memory loss distorts reality in our exclusive clip from This Tempting Madness, inspired by a true story.

The mind-bending psychological thriller will be released in select theaters and on demand on June 12 via Vertical.

Simone Ashley (“Bridgerton”) stars as Mia, who awakens from a coma, grievously injured, her memory fractured. As she puts the pieces of her past together, she starts to question her own actions and her perception of reality.

Jennifer E. Montgomery makes her feature directorial debut from a script she co-wrote with director of photography Andrew Davis, inspired by Montgomery’s first-hand experience with tragedy involving her best friend.

“Months before the incident, there were signals that her world was unraveling,” says Montgomery. “I could feel the pressure building, though I didn’t know what form it would take. I never could have known what violence would come, and I certainly never imagined making a film about it.”

Austin Stowell (“NCIS: Origins”), Suraj Sharma (Happy Death Day 2U), Mojean Aria (Reminiscence), Amol Shah (“For All Mankind”), and Zenobia Shroff (“Ms. Marvel”) round out the cast.

Smoke Jumper Films and Mango Monster Productions produce in association with Catchlight Studios (HereticThe Blackening).

This Tempting Madness is rated R for “language, violence/bloody images, and brief sexuality.”
